Going to Carlsbad Raceway today to run the 1/4 mile there

Today and tomorrow are the last two days and then Sunday after the last of the bracket racing is done the track will be shut down for good.

The earth movers have been there for a while tearing up the dirt track next to the 1/4 mile strip and now they are ready to eat it up too - like we really need another business park right there

For those who were in to dirt bike riding in the late 60s and 70s, Carlsbad was the site of the US GP Motocross track and was always talked about in the dirt bike magazines of the day.

You can't ride a dirt bike anywhere around here now without being ticketed.

Anyway, I plan to do a run in stock mode and in the Hi Performance tune as a minimum. If the crowd isn't too bad I'll try to do a couple in each, and maybe even a run in the other modes if time permits.

Made it to the track and did a couple of runs in stock and Hi Perf tune.

Goofed up the first run because I let the truck creep out of the stage and across the line while trying to hold some boost and red lighted. Sat there in wonderment for a couple of seconds watching the other guy before I left the line. So the ET for that run rather stank.

I should note that my truck is stock except for the SCMT. Only other mod is the X-Monitor and brake controller.

Here are the numbers:

Run 1 - Stock Tune
4.688 --- 60 ft
8.970 --- 330 ft
12.643 --- 1/8 ET
66.790 --- 1/8 MPH
18.573 --- 1/4 ET
84.200 --- 1/4 MPH

Run 2 - Stock Tune
2.134 --- 60 ft
6.415 --- 330 ft
10.091 --- 1/8 ET
66.520 --- 1/8 MPH
16.033 --- 1/4 ET
83.880 --- 1/4 MPH

Run 3 - High Performance Tune
1.924 --- 60 ft
5.759 --- 330 ft
9.062 --- 1/8 ET
74.200 --- 1/8 MPH
14.332 --- 1/4 ET
93.270 --- 1/4 MPH

Run 4 - High Performance Tune
1.902 --- 60 ft
5.746 --- 330 ft
9.060 --- 1/8 ET
74.020 --- 1/8 MPH
14.338 --- 1/4 ET
93.01 --- 1/4 MPH

The runs were mostly made launching at about 2000 RPM. In the Hi Performance tune I noted that the boost was hitting around 12 or 14 lbs during some practice launches earlier in the day on a vacant dead end street not far from my house.

Hi EGT on the stock runs was 871 and 917 or something like that, and max boost was 24.7.

The max EGT during the Hi Performance runs was 1181 and max boost was 30.7 or 31.7, I forget which.

I would have made a few more runs experimenting with how much RPM to hold before the launch but the lines were pretty long so I called it a day.

So from this small sample size, stock ET is about 16.0 s flat at 84 MPH, and Hi Performance tune ET is 14.335 s at 93.1 MPH.

The track is probably about 100 ft above sea level and the outside temp was about 75 deg. Folks did comment that traction was as good as usual today - though in 4WD I didn't notice that I was spinning much.
